The smart remote key is found on most newer BMWs. It can lock, unlock and even start the car at the push of a button. These advanced keys are powered by an internal battery that can get worn out over time, causing it to cease functioning or even shut off completely. The good news is that replacing the battery in your BMW key fob is a relatively simple task that can be done at home.
Most BMWs have an ultra-secure transponder key that includes an individual microchip. The chip is laser-cut and is able to communicate only with a single car. This makes it harder for thieves to copy your keys or use a fake key to start your car. Key Fob Batteries
The key fob battery powers the device, making it so easy to lock and unlock your car or remote start it from the inside of your home. As time passes, the battery will need replacing.

Key fob batteries are small button cell batteries that typically have a plus and plus sign to indicate the type of battery. It's simple to change the battery since they are all the same size. The fob can be opened using a flat-head screwscrew. This may take a little force, so be careful not to break the fob. Depending on the kind of key fob that you have it might be broken into two pieces with a notch along one edge that pops apart.
After the fob is opened and the battery is located, you can locate it. It will appear like a small silver coin. Remove the battery that was in use and then carefully place the new one. Make sure it is oriented the same way. After the fob is installed, test all of its remotes to ensure they function as you expect.
Certain key fobs require only one battery, whereas other key fobs (like those found on older Honda vehicles), require two. Look up the owner's manual for specific guidelines prior to purchasing a second. Also, confirm that the battery is the right one for your vehicle.

Key Fob Programming
Many of the latest models of cars have key fobs that can be remotely programmed by using a special computer or a key fob reprogramming software. These tools help vehicle owners professionals, as well as others manage their fobs. They can alter the access level of their keys, make new ones, and much more. These tools can be used to detect issues and determine if a fob needs replacement. Some key fob reprogramming software are able of reading and writing EEPROM data on the car's system and can even program remote start functions, when your vehicle supports it.

While some replacement fobs are available only at the dealership, most can be prepared and programmed by a local locksmith. Locksmiths tend to be less expensive than dealerships and offer faster service. However it is not every locksmith has the necessary equipment to deal with certain types of vehicles and therefore it is essential to inquire about their credentials before hiring them. A locksmith that specializes in key fobs is acquainted with the security system of the vehicle, which reduces the possibility of damaging information stored in its module.

The key fob contains many small, complex components that work together to produce the signals that connect to the car's security system. These include a microprocessor that handles the key fob's functions as well as a key chip which stores key codes and an electronic transmitter that transmits the signal. A battery powers the transmitter and other electronic components. A case also protects the key fob and its internal components.
